Re: PolyMesh Duplicator v1.1

Posted: 15 Nov 2009, 00:23
by nassosy
Each duplicate uses the SRT/Transform matrix of the particle whose ID matches its CopyID
If no particle exists, the SRT of the duplicate is random/undefined (you will usually get garbage).

So always make sure there are as many particles as duplicates
When the # of (born) Particles >= # of Duplicates, the large object will disappear
